What Are Conservation Vents?
Conservation vents are pressure relief devices installed on storage tanks to regulate internal pressure levels. They are designed to release excess pressure or vacuum, preventing overpressure or collapse, both of which can result in hazardous or costly situations.
Types of Conservation Vents
- Pressure/Vacuum Relief Vents: Regulate both overpressure and vacuum conditions in the tank.
- Pressure Relief Vents: Focus exclusively on relieving excess internal pressure.
These vents typically contain a compression spring and valve plate that opens once the tank reaches a preset pressure threshold, allowing gas or vapor to escape and restore safe conditions.
Why Engineering Teams Must Understand Conservation Vents
Engineering teams are responsible for the design, installation, and maintenance of storage tank systems. A thorough understanding of conservation vents is essential for ensuring system integrity and safety. Here's why:
1. Safety
The primary function of conservation vents is to prevent overpressure, which can lead to dangerous explosions or tank ruptures. Engineers must ensure proper vent selection, sizing, and placement to mitigate these risks and maintain a safe operating environment.
2. Regulatory Compliance
OSHA, API, and other industry standards mandate the use of pressure relief devices such as conservation vents on storage tanks. Engineering teams must understand how these vents contribute to regulatory compliance and ensure installations meet all applicable codes.
3. Equipment Protection
Excessive pressure can damage tank walls, fittings, and other components. By installing conservation vents, engineering teams help prevent such damage, extend equipment life, and reduce the need for costly repairs or replacements.
